$BTC Liquidation #Heatmap Insight
The heatmap shows key zones where high-leverage trades are likely to be liquidated.
These areas often attract price action, as large players aim to trigger stop losses and collect liquidity.
Such maps help identify potential volatility zones in the market.

#Heatmap A heat map is a visual representation of data that uses colors to illustrate the intensity or magnitude of the data points. In finance, heat maps are often used to display:

1. *Market trends*: Showing which sectors or stocks are performing well or poorly.
2. *Price movements*: Visualizing price changes over time.
3. *Trading volumes*: Highlighting areas of high or low trading activity.

Heat maps help identify patterns, trends, and anomalies, making complex data easier to understand and analyze.

The Heatmap: Your Eye on Market Liquidity

The heatmap is a powerful tool for spotting liquidity imbalances. It shows where traders have placed their orders at different price levels, which can help predict price movements. Understanding the heatmap gives you an edge in identifying potential liquidity grabs—massive price swings that occur when large orders target specific price zones.
• Above Current Price: These lines represent short positions. When the price rises to hit these levels, shorts get liquidated, creating a cascade effect and often reversing the price.
• Below Current Price: These lines represent long positions. A drop in price aims at these positions, triggering liquidations, followed by a potential price reversal.

Examples in Action:
1. Targeting Shorts (Upward Wick): A wick moves upward to clear short positions. This triggers a liquidation cascade, with the price potentially reversing downward shortly after.
2. Up, Then Down (Shakeout): The price rises, shakes out short positions, and then drops sharply, liquidating long positions before reversing again.
3. Down to Clear Longs: A wick moves downward to clear long positions. Once liquidated, the market reverses, leaving those traders out.
4. Double Liquidity Grab: The price shoots up to liquidate shorts, then drops to clear long positions. The price may reverse after both sides are shaken out.

The heatmap helps you visualize where liquidity is sitting, allowing you to anticipate where these massive moves might happen. By tracking these levels, you can avoid getting caught in liquidations and position yourself for profitable trades.
